Nestled in Torquay, the Babbacombe Model Village offers a delightful glimpse into English village life, all in miniature. This intricate display features over 400 models, including quaint cottages, lush gardens, and tiny modes of transport, alongside iconic landmarks like Stonehenge and Windsor Castle. Populated by approximately 13,000 miniature figures, the village provides a detailed and immersive experience for visitors. Today, families can explore this charming, scaled-down world, discovering the meticulous craftsmanship and attention to detail that brings each scene to life.
